Multiparametric System for Measuring Physicochemical Variables Associated to Water Quality Based on the Arduino Platform

Abstract: Traditionally, the estimation of water quality is realized through laboratory analysis which is time-consuming and requires specialized installations, equipment, and personnel. Nowadays, it is possible to make real-time water monitoring through electrochemical sensors, microcontrollers, and central processing units, for detecting water pollutants.
